Hey Mike not saying the LRS product doesn't perform, referring to wind noise and stereos in general. I have two different shields I ride with, when I go for the longer hauls I put a Hammock seat on (immediately removing any cool factor on my bike) and a it sets me up 5" higher than the Danny Grey, so I also swap out to a 15" shield, the combination has me looking through. With the Danny Grey I run with a 6.5" klockwerx which I look over. Between the twoI get more wind noise on the DG, Klockwerx setup. My orginal setup was Arc Audio mini amp and Hertz 6x9 Hcx speakers, played good but I would loose clarity at the higher speeds (short shield and 70). I added some cycle sound bag lids with Polk db 691's later and swapped out to a RF PBR 300 x 4, in the garage the system was fantastic, at higher speeds on the highway you could hear it but a lot of the clarity was gone.
I put in a JL MHD 600 in, Audio Frog 6x9s in the Faring, and the Hertz in the bag lids, this setup is load and clear at any speed my bike runs with any shield. The aftermarket road king fairings have an advantage over glides, room, they have many more choices for amp selection, The reason the Sound Stream, ARC, Rockford Fosgate class D Amps are popular is that's what you can cram in the fairing on the glides.
